According to the local senior of this place, Lauti waterfall was named as Lauti because a banjhatri called Lauti used to bathe in this waterfall and many children who look after cattle usually come around were brought by the banjhantri and sent to learn various witchcraft and diviner vidya. Previously, using the water of this fall a large commercial of trout fish farm has been operated a little lower from the fall. Simultaneously, Kalanga Tea Garden, Mahadev Cave along with other small Caves can be observed.
About 50 meters high Lauti Waterfall is also the main attraction of Jiri and a destination for most of the tourist.
How to reach: you can get to this place from Jiri Manedanda through a paved road of about 3 km. The way to this fall is best for hiking. it can be reached from Manedanda in about 1 hour.
What to bring: if you are going for the hike, it is best to bring some light food and water along with you.
